About this Event

Explore sound captioning as an art form in this hands-on workshop with composer and multimedia artist Jay Afrisando. Participants will experiment with sound description, considering accessibility, art, ethics, and ecology, and collectively develop practices for artistic and critical engagement with auditory experiences. Jay Afrisando, a neurodivergent artist, works across music-theater, installation, film, and storytelling to expand aural diversity, accessibility, and decolonized approaches to sound.
